Transaction 6c3366893f73efb13c3c827a20ded669a222a0f249c7c2792737d743089bd47b
1 Input
1 Output
-
6c3366893f73efb13c3c827a20ded669a222a0f249c7c2792737d743089bd47b:0
- value
- 352645940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f56d2c2b0c6aea542faef5a3b479f01b4c3f12fb OP_EQUAL
- address
- MWGrZsN2fLYbVLMQcWsd4MFV6y6cUJzuGL